What This Means (2024 FDD)

According to Crown Gold Exchange's 2024 Franchise Disclosure Document, the Rancho Santa Margarita, CA location had gross sales of $5,000,771 for the period of January 1, 2023 to December 31, 2023. This data is based on the financial performance of company-owned outlets, specifically WAM Gold, LLC, which Crown Gold Exchange states do not differ materially from future franchise-owned outlets. The FDD clarifies that "Gross Sales" means the revenue from sales of goods or services, less sales tax, discounts, and returns.

It is important to note that this figure represents gross sales only. The FDD explicitly states that this Item 19 does not include any operating expenses. A prospective Crown Gold Exchange franchisee would need to account for costs such as goods, labor, advertising, and rent to determine net income. The FDD also mentions an estimated royalty fee of $12,000 for the Rancho Santa Margarita location, even though the affiliate-owned businesses do not actually pay royalties. This provides an estimate of what a franchisee might expect to pay in royalties.

The FDD also includes a disclaimer that individual results may vary, and there is no assurance that a franchisee will achieve the same level of sales or earnings. The document advises prospective franchisees that written substantiation of the information will be made available upon reasonable request. Furthermore, the FDD urges franchisees to report any financial performance information or projections not included in Item 19 to the franchisor and relevant regulatory agencies.
